Engine Design and Configuration

The Mitsubishi 4G15 Engine is a compact 1.5-liter inline-four engine designed for efficiency and versatility. Its lightweight aluminum block reduces overall vehicle weight, improving fuel economy and handling. The engine's inline-four configuration ensures smooth operation by balancing vibrations effectively. This design also optimizes space, making it ideal for compact vehicles.

  

One of the standout features of the 4G15 engine is its advanced piston and cylinder design. The pistons maintain airtightness between the cylinder walls, minimizing leakage and enhancing thermal efficiency. Additionally, the oil control system scrapes excess oil from the cylinder walls, preventing carbon deposits and maintaining normal fuel consumption. These engineering innovations contribute to the engine's durability and performance.

SOHC vs. DOHC Variants

The Mitsubishi 4G15 Engine comes in two main variants: Single Overhead Camshaft (SOHC) and Dual Overhead Camshaft (DOHC). Each variant offers unique advantages, catering to different driving preferences and needs.

SOHC engines feature a simpler design with fewer moving parts. This simplicity makes them easier to maintain and more cost-effective to produce. However, they may have limitations in high RPM performance due to increased mass and rocker arms. On the other hand, DOHC engines excel in high RPM scenarios. They use direct-acting cams, reducing mass and improving airflow efficiency. This design allows for better performance in modern passenger and performance vehicles.

  

Feature SOHC (Single Overhead Cam) DOHC (Dual Overhead Cam)
Valves per Cylinder 2, 3, or 4 (one intake, one exhaust) 2, 4, or 5 (dedicated intake and exhaust cams)
Airflow Efficiency 50% (2 valves), 64% (3 valves), 68% (4 valves) 50% (2 valves), 68% (4 valves), diminishing returns for 5 valves
High RPM Performance Limited due to rocker arms and increased mass Superior due to direct acting cams and reduced mass
Cost of Production Generally lower, but can be higher for multivalve Higher due to complexity and engineering demands
Complexity Simpler design, easier maintenance More complex, especially in V and boxer engines
Use Cases Common in budget cars Standard in modern passenger and performance cars

  

When choosing between SOHC and DOHC variants, you should consider your priorities. If you value simplicity and cost-effectiveness, SOHC may be the better option. For those seeking high performance and advanced technology, DOHC is the preferred choice.

Performance Capabilities of the Mitsubishi 4G15 Engine

  

Horsepower and Torque Output

The Mitsubishi 4G15 Engine offers a range of horsepower and torque outputs, depending on its configuration. These variations cater to different driving needs, from everyday commuting to high-performance applications. Below is a breakdown of the engine's performance across its key variants:

  

Engine Configuration Horsepower (hp) Torque (N⋅m)
SOHC 4G15 94 N/A
DOHC 4G15 109 137
DOHC GDI 100 137
DOHC MIVEC Turbo 165 N/A
Colt CZT Ralliart 197 N/A

  

The SOHC variant delivers a modest 94 horsepower, making it ideal for fuel-efficient city driving. The DOHC configurations, on the other hand, provide enhanced power and torque, with the DOHC MIVEC Turbo variant reaching an impressive 165 horsepower. For those seeking peak performance, the Colt CZT Ralliart variant stands out with a remarkable 197 horsepower. These figures demonstrate the engine's adaptability to various performance requirements.

Applications in Mitsubishi Models

The Mitsubishi 4G15 Engine has powered a wide range of Mitsubishi vehicles, showcasing its versatility. You’ll find this engine in compact cars, sedans, and even performance-oriented models. Some notable applications include:

  • Mitsubishi Lancer: A popular choice for its balance of efficiency and performance.
  • Mitsubishi Colt: Known for its compact design and urban-friendly capabilities.
  • Mitsubishi Mirage: A fuel-efficient option for budget-conscious drivers.
  • Colt CZT Ralliart: A high-performance variant designed for enthusiasts.

Each model leverages the engine's strengths to meet specific driving demands. For instance, the Mirage prioritizes fuel economy, while the Colt CZT Ralliart focuses on delivering exhilarating performance. This adaptability makes the Mitsubishi 4G15 Engine a cornerstone of Mitsubishi's lineup.

Common Issues and Maintenance Tips

Known Problems and Their Causes

The Mitsubishi 4G15 engine is reliable, but like any engine, it has some common issues. One frequent problem is oil leaks, often caused by worn-out gaskets or seals. Over time, these components degrade, leading to oil seepage. Another issue involves timing belt wear. If the timing belt is not replaced at the recommended intervals, it can snap, causing severe engine damage.

  

You may also encounter carbon buildup in the intake valves, especially in GDI (Gasoline Direct Injection) variants. This occurs due to incomplete combustion and can reduce engine efficiency. Additionally, overheating can result from a failing water pump or a clogged radiator. Identifying these issues early can save you from costly repairs.

  

Preventative Maintenance Strategies

Preventative maintenance is key to keeping your 4G15 engine in top condition. Start by checking the oil level and quality regularly. Replace the oil and filter as per the manufacturer’s recommendations. Inspect the timing belt for signs of wear, such as cracks or fraying, and replace it every 60,000 to 100,000 miles.

  

Clean the intake system periodically to prevent carbon buildup. Use high-quality fuel to minimize deposits. Ensure the cooling system is functioning properly by flushing the radiator and replacing the coolant as needed. These steps will help you avoid major engine problems.

FAQ

What is the lifespan of the Mitsubishi 4G15 engine?

With proper maintenance, the 4G15 engine can last over 200,000 miles. Regular oil changes, timely belt replacements, and quality fuel usage significantly extend its lifespan.

How often should you replace the timing belt?

Replace the timing belt every 60,000 to 100,000 miles. Check your vehicle's manual for the exact interval to avoid potential engine damage.

Tip: Inspect the belt for cracks or wear during routine maintenance to prevent unexpected failures.

  

Does the 4G15 engine require premium fuel?

Most 4G15 variants run efficiently on regular unleaded fuel. However, turbocharged models may require premium fuel for optimal performance. Always refer to your vehicle's manual.

Note: Using the recommended fuel type ensures better combustion and prevents engine knocking.
